Are people in Denver older or younger than people in Buffalo Center?
- The Median Age in Denver is 21.5 years younger than in Buffalo Center.

Are housing costs cheaper in Denver or Buffalo Center?
- Denver housing costs are 449.1% more expensive than Buffalo Center hous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Denver or Buffalo Center?
- The average commute for residents of Denver is 7.5 minutes longer than it is for residents of Buffalo Center.

Things to do in Denver?
Denver, Colorado is a wonderful city for those wanting to explore the great outdoors and vibrant culture. Take in the views of the Rocky Mountains from the sky-high observation decks or take a scenic drive down 16th Street Mall. Enjoy activities like hiking and biking in City Park or take a stroll along Cherry Creek trail and enjoy some of nature's finest offerings. Explore world-famous museums such as the Denver Art Museum or catch a show at Red Rocks Amphitheater. With its creative spirit, lively music scene, and abundance of outdoor activities, Denver has something for everyone!
